GoScan:从零开始掌握网络自动扫描的完整指南
【免费下载链接】goscanInteractive Network Scanner项目地址: https://gitcode.com/gh_mirrors/go/goscan
GoScan作为一款交互式网络扫描工具,正在重新定义网络安全评估的便捷性。无论你是刚接触网络安全的初学者,还是寻求效率提升的专业人士,这款基于Go语言开发的开源工具都能让你在5分钟内启动第一次专业级扫描。
🚀 快速启动:5分钟完成首次扫描
GoScan的设计理念就是让复杂的网络扫描变得简单直观。你不需要记忆繁琐的nmap命令参数,只需要简单的几个步骤:
- 环境准备:GoScan原生支持Linux环境,特别适合在Kali Linux等安全发行版中使用
- 一键启动:通过命令行直接运行,工具会自动加载所需模块
- 交互引导:内置的自动补全功能会引导你完成扫描配置
从启动界面可以看到,GoScan在Kali Linux环境中运行流畅,界面简洁明了,即使是新手也能快速上手。
🔍 核心机制:四步完成专业扫描
GoScan的强大之处在于其精心设计的扫描流程,将复杂的网络探测分解为四个清晰的阶段:
目标加载 → 主机发现 → 端口扫描 → 服务枚举
每个阶段都有专门的模块负责,数据通过SQLite数据库在不同模块间传递,确保扫描过程的连贯性和稳定性。
这个流程图清晰地展示了GoScan的工作机制:首先从命令行或文件加载扫描目标,然后通过SWEEP模块识别存活主机,接着进行端口扫描,最后对发现的服务进行详细枚举。
💡 实战场景:从理论到应用
在实际使用中,GoScan能够应对多种网络安全场景:
渗透测试加速:在时间紧迫的渗透测试中,GoScan的自动化流程可以快速识别网络中的关键资产和服务漏洞。
CTF竞赛利器:面对复杂的CTF挑战,GoScan的快速扫描能力让你在竞争对手中脱颖而出。
安全评估标准化:通过预定义的扫描模板,确保每次评估都遵循相同的标准和流程。
🎯 进阶技巧:发挥最大潜力
当你熟悉基础操作后,可以探索GoScan的更多高级功能:
自定义扫描策略:根据具体需求调整扫描参数,平衡速度与深度
结果分析与导出:利用内置工具对扫描结果进行深入分析和报告生成
工具链集成:与EyeWitness、Hydra等专业工具的无缝配合,构建完整的攻击链
✅ 为什么选择GoScan?
与传统扫描工具相比,GoScan具有明显的优势:
学习曲线平缓:交互式界面和自动补全让新手也能快速掌握专业扫描技术
环境适应性强:即使在网络不稳定的情况下,基于数据库的设计也能确保扫描任务不中断
功能模块化:清晰的模块划分让用户可以根据需要选择使用特定功能
GoScan不仅仅是一个工具,更是你进入网络安全世界的得力助手。它用简单的方式实现了复杂的功能,让每个人都能享受到专业级网络扫描带来的便利和效率。
【免费下载链接】goscanInteractive Network Scanner项目地址: https://gitcode.com/gh_mirrors/go/goscan
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考